Not Up Close, But Personal: Aerial Photographer Prefers Paraglider To Drone

Video shows a photographer flying over the Colorado River Delta in Mexico in his powered paraglider as part of his mission to tell stories from the air in a more personal way, rather than using an “impersonal” drone. His aerial photographs capture some of the most spectacular places in the world. Joe Orsi, who is from Kansas but now lives […]
